Brushless DC Motor Technology in Height Adjustable Desks: Benefits & Trends
Height adjustable desks are rapidly gaining popularity, and the engine of their smooth, reliable operation is often a brushless DC (BLDC) motor. These motors offer significant benefits over traditional brushed DC motors, primarily through increased longevity. BLDC motors eliminate the necessity for brushes, reducing friction and damage, which directly translates to a longer motor span and quieter operation—a crucial factor in office environments. Today, trends indicate a transition towards more sophisticated BLDC motor control systems, incorporating features like adaptive learning, which allows the desk to memorize preferred heights for individual users, and enhanced safety mechanisms like collision detection. Furthermore, manufacturers are examining the use of smaller, more petite BLDC motors to further lessen desk size and boost overall design aesthetics.
- Increased Efficiency: BLDC motors are more efficient than brushed motors.
- Extended Lifespan: Reduced damage leads to a longer period.
- Quieter Operation: The absence of brushes allows for quieter function.
- Adaptive Learning: Desks can save user preferences.
- Safety Features: Collision detection systems are becoming standard.
